Special stitches may speed healing after wisdom tooth removal
Symptom relief Recruiting nowThis study looks at whether stitches coated with an antibacterial agent (triclosan) help the gums heal better and reduce bacteria after removing impacted wisdom teeth. New pad aims to clean wounds faster and safer
Symptom relief Recruiting nowThis study is testing a special pad used to clean wounds by removing dead tissue and debris.
